现在的位置: 首页 > 综合 > 正文

js为select动态添加option,使用webservice提供数据

2012年08月10日 ⁄ 综合 ⁄ 共 764字 ⁄ 字号 评论关闭

 <head runat="server">
    <title>动态添加option</title>
    <script>
        function myclick()
        {
            WebService.GetDayEnum(onSuccess);
        }
        function onSuccess(result)
        {
            var myselect= document.getElementById("myselect");
            for(var i=0;i<8;i++)
            {
                myselect.options[i] = new Option(result[i],i); 
            }
        }
    </script>
</head>
<body onload="myclick();">
    <form id="form1" runat="server">
    <asp:ScriptManager ID="ScriptManager1" runat="server">
        <Services>
            <asp:ServiceReference Path="~/WebService.asmx" />
        </Services>
    </asp:ScriptManager>
    <div>
        <input type="button" value="test" onclick="myclick();"/>
        <select id="myselect">
              
        </select>
    </div>
    </form>
</body>

抱歉!评论已关闭.